Hardscaping Service in Fairfield County, CT
Hardscaping services encompass the design, installation, and enhancement of durable outdoor features that improve the functionality and aesthetics of residential properties. Common projects include the construction of pat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, fire pits, and outdoor kitchens. These features not only add visual appeal but also create practical spaces for outdoor living and entertaining. Property owners often seek hardscaping to define outdoor areas, improve curb appeal, or increase property value, making it essential to understand the scope of work, materials used, and the overall design process before requesting services.
Before initiating a hardscaping project, homeowners should consider factors such as the intended use of the space, preferred materials, and budget constraints. It’s also helpful to think about the existing landscape and how new features will integrate with the current environment. Planning for drainage, durability, and maintenance requirements can influence material choices and design decisions. Clear communication about project goals and expectations can ensure that the finished hardscape aligns with the property owner’s vision and functional needs.

Common Hardscaping Service Jobs
Patio Installation - creates functional outdoor spaces for entertaining and relaxing.
Retaining Walls - provides erosion control and adds visual interest to landscaping.
Walkways and Pathways - enhances accessibility and defines different areas of a property.
Driveway Paving - improves curb appeal and provides a durable surface for vehicles.
Fire Pits and Outdoor Kitchens - adds outdoor comfort and functionality for gatherings.
Stepping Stones and Decorative Elements - adds charm and character to garden and yard designs.
Hardscaping Service Questions
What types of hardscaping projects are common? Common projects include patios, walkways, retaining walls, and outdoor fireplaces to enhance functionality and aesthetics.
What materials are used in hardscaping? Materials such as stone, brick, concrete, and pavers are typically used to create durable and attractive surfaces.
How does hardscaping improve property value? Well-designed hardscaping adds curb appeal and outdoor living space, which can increase property value.
What should homeowners consider before starting a hardscaping project? It’s important to plan for drainage, durability, and how the design complements existing landscaping.
